In a properly working system when not in re-circulation mode the HVAC system draws air in from the outside through the front cowling fresh air intake through the cabin air filter. It heats/cools this fresh air and pushes it into the cabin where it mixes with and conditions the current cabin air. Web15 jun. 2024 · What is HVAC? Builders, contractors and homeowners alike may believe that the … Web12 apr. 2024 · Assuming an upper tank temperature of 120F, a high efficiency circulator between the tank and a 5-in. x 12-in. x 50 plate heat exchanger could yield an output of 4 gpm of domestic water heated from 50F to 115F with a power input of about 30 watts. A small recirculation circulator would add another 12 watts of power input.
